Local Development

Makefile (Recommended)

make init
cp sample.env .env  # Add your DEEPGRAM_API_KEY
make start

Open http://localhost:8080 (opens in new tab) in your browser.

Python & pnpm

git clone --recurse-submodules https://github.com/deepgram-starters/flask-transcription.git
cd flask-transcription
python3 -m venv venv
./venv/bin/pip install -r requirements.txt
cd frontend && corepack pnpm install && cd ..
cp sample.env .env  # Add your DEEPGRAM_API_KEY

Start both servers in separate terminals:

# Terminal 1 - Backend (port 8081)
./venv/bin/python app.py

# Terminal 2 - Frontend (port 8080)
cd frontend && corepack pnpm run dev -- --port 8080 --no-open

Open http://localhost:8080 (opens in new tab) in your browser.
